Financing Solutions
Browsing History
39 Seton Park Rd, Toronto
1 second ago
117B The Queensway TH89, Toronto
1 second ago
1750 Bayview Ave 210, Toronto
2 seconds ago
14 Seton Park Rd, Toronto
2 seconds ago
AS SEEN ON

Todd Brook Dr Real Estate
About Todd Brook Dr Real Estate in Toronto
Todd Brook Dr is located in Toronto. All properties on Todd Brook Dr are detached homes. There are curently no properties for sale on Todd Brook Dr in Toronto.
Detached homes on Todd Brook Dr in Toronto are situated on lots with an average frontage of 56' and a maximum frontage of 100', varying between 2 and 6 bedrooms. The highest price a detached home has ever been listed at on Todd Brook Dr in Toronto is $929,700 and the highest price a detached home has ever sold for is $905,000. The most recent sale of a detached home occured on July 23, 2020. Detached homes on Todd Brook Dr take on average of 34 days to sell.
Todd Brook Dr Addresses
Are You a Licensed Real Estate Agent or Broker?